2. Overcome the Cloud Talent Gap

Does keeping your team updated with the latest Azure advancements feel like a continuous effort that requires significant time and resources? Is it difficult to find the right expertise you can trust on budget?

Finding and maintaining skilled cloud professionals is a significant challenge for many organizations. A 2024 HashiCorp survey revealed that 64% of organizations still lack the staff expertise they need to support their cloud infrastructure strategy comprehensively. 

This is why many organizations choose an experienced partner that can provide a dedicated team of Azure-certified cloud experts to create a cohesive strategy that eliminates operational silos, enhances efficiency and allows your IT team to focus on their core functions without getting bogged down by technical hurdles.

3. Surmounting Cloud Security Hurdles

Are you worried about safeguarding sensitive information from breaches and unauthorized access? Are you finding it complex to meet industry-specific compliance standards and regulations? Are you concerned about the potential loss of intellectual property due to vulnerabilities in AI systems?

Security is always a priority in the cloud. With the increasing sophistication of cyberthreats, ensuring robust security protocols and compliance across the cloud environment becomes paramount. Businesses often face difficulties in identifying vulnerabilities and establishing the necessary security measures to protect sensitive data and applications.

Your expert partner can provide much relief for these pain points. A comprehensive managed services engagement for Azure should include robust security features such as advanced threat detection, real-time monitoring and incident response to ensure your environment remains secure.
